Output 891f67a4020784277bd730dd37a56dc4e35b9c3ea01262418b0d78874eaa161e:1

value
8454553
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d755b3d2399b5dacb7997af16d289a8ccf04bb5 OP_EQUAL
address
32vBJ6wiAEzkQHPL1WL8hKipAXMd9JsaNk
transaction
891f67a4020784277bd730dd37a56dc4e35b9c3ea01262418b0d78874eaa161e